Fire Dragon Soba is a contemporary urban legends japanese tale that circulates in Japan, particularly among younger generations and internet users. This legend revolves around a mysterious and potentially dangerous bowl of soba (buckwheat noodles) that is said to be cursed or imbued with supernatural qualities.

Fire Dragon Soba legend are not well-documented, but it appears to have emerged in the late 20th century as part of the growing trend of urban legends fueled by internet culture. The story often begins with a person who visits a specific soba shop known for its unique dish called “Fire Dragon Soba.” According to the tale, this dish is prepared using an ancient recipe that involves special ingredients believed to invoke the spirit of a dragon.
Fire Dragon Soba is typically described as being extremely spicy, with some versions claiming it contains ingredients that can cause hallucinations or intense physical reactions. The noodles are often depicted as being served in a fiery broth, sometimes accompanied by dramatic presentations such as flames or smoke. The experience of consuming this dish is said to be both exhilarating and terrifying.
The central theme of the legend involves a curse associated with eating Fire Dragon Soba. It is said that those who consume this dish may experience strange phenomena, such as visions of dragons or other mythical creatures. In some variations, individuals report feeling an overwhelming sense of heat or even being pursued by an unseen force after eating the soba. These experiences contribute to the fear surrounding the dish and its potential consequences.
